Output 581265108e084429b7656132a51b3d8745776f385153da583721756caf3afd74:0

value
3635013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dff986cabd25bca143fc8b6619cac2e3e72cd21 OP_EQUAL
address
3K1dpszaZsroGceFCHD15QHcF1wESjY6yN
transaction
581265108e084429b7656132a51b3d8745776f385153da583721756caf3afd74
spent
true